VLT Laser Guide Star Facility. Panoramic view of the Laser Guide Star Facility at the European Southern Observatory's VLT (Very Large Telescope), Cerro Paranal, Chile. The laser (PARSEC) produces this orange beam to create an artificial guide star in the atmosphere. This facility began operating on 28th January 2006, in the VLT's Yepun telescope (far right). By focusing on the artificial guide star, VLT telescopes are calibrated to remove the effects of the atmosphere on observations, a process known as adaptive optics. | |
